A CARER who repeatedly exposed himself in full view of his neighbours has been spared jail.

Lee Parker, 48, of Wilson Marriage Road, Colchester, stood naked in a tree house in his garden and carried out sex acts.

At Colchester Magistrates’ Court yesterday, he admitted three counts of indecent exposure.

Parker apologised to the court, claiming he was lonely, devoting his time to caring for his severely disabled daughter.

Colette Harper, prosecuting, said Parker carried out the offences in April last year, May last year and July this year, when police were called.

James O’Toole, mitigating, said: “These incidents acted as a wake-up call. He is ashamed and disgraced at what he has done.

“It was partly motivated by extreme loneliness.

“He is caring for his severely disabled daughter and is under considerable stress.

“There is no justification, but this is some explanation.”

Parker was made the subject of a three-year supervision order and must take part in a course to change his behaviour.

He will also be placed on the sex offenders’ register.

He was spared jail due to his early guilty plea, previous good character and the impact it would have on his daughter, who needs him as a carer.

The court also ordered him to pay £145 costs.
